The Quezon Memorial Shrine is a Monument and National Shrine dedicated to former Commonwealth of the Philippines President Manuel Quezon, located within the Grounds of Quezon Memorial Circle in Quezon City, Philippines Designed by Filipino Architect Federico Ilustre.

The Coconut Palace, also known as Tahanang Pilipino, meaning “Filipino Home”, is a Government Building located in the Cultural Center of the Philippines Complex designed by Filipino Architect Francisco Mañosa.

The Manila Metropolitan Theater or the Tanghalang Metropolitan; also known as the Metropolitan Theater is a Performing Arts Center, historic Philippine Art Deco building located in Plaza Lawton in Ermita, Manila. It is recognized as the forefront of the Art Deco architectural style in the Philippines Designed by Architect Juan Arellano. Most of the time it called as the Met, as short for Metropolitan.
